Sealing ring processing and shaping device
Technical Field
The utility model relates to a sealing ring processing technology field specifically is a sealing ring processing setting device.
Background
The sealing ring is an annular sealing element with a notch, is tightly propped against the inner hole wall of the static element by the elasticity of the pressed sealing ring, plays a role in sealing, and simultaneously needs to use a shaping device when processing and shaping.
The existing shaping device has long cooling and shaping time for materials, so that the working efficiency of the device is reduced, the device is not convenient to disassemble for periodic cleaning after working is finished, redundant materials are remained on the device to influence the next use, the use is not convenient enough, and the existing equipment needs to be improved aiming at the problems.

Detailed Description

Referring to fig. 1-3, the present invention provides a technical solution: the utility model provides a sealing ring processing setting device, as shown in figure 1, seted up aqua storage tank 2 in the plummer 1, and the front side of aqua storage tank 2 is provided with electronic water valve 3, electronic water valve 3 runs through the left and right sides of the preceding terminal surface of plummer 1 simultaneously, electronic water valve 3 symmetry sets up the front side at aqua storage tank 2, can let in water and condensing agent to aqua storage tank 2 after opening electronic water valve 3, the heat in the material is through in first mould cover 7 heat-conduction to aqua storage tank 2 this moment, thereby accelerate design speed, with this save operating time.
According to the drawings of fig. 1 and 2, a first groove 4 is formed on the upper end surface of a bearing platform 1, a first mold 5 is arranged in the first groove 4, the first mold 5 is fixed on the bearing platform 1 through a first fixing bolt 6, the first mold 5 is in threaded connection with the bearing platform 1 through the first fixing bolt 6, the first fixing bolt 6 is symmetrically arranged, the first mold 5 can be fixed on the bearing platform 1 through rotating the first fixing bolt 6, so that the subsequent material shaping and the first mold 5 dismounting work can be facilitated, a first mold sleeve 7 is fixed at the bottom of the first mold 5, the first mold sleeve 7 is arranged in a water storage tank 2, the top of the first mold sleeve 7 is arranged in a clamping groove 8, the clamping groove 8 is arranged on a top cover 9, the top cover 9 is in clamping connection with the bearing platform 1 through the connecting mode between the clamping groove 8, and the top cover 9 is clamped and placed on the bearing platform 1, so that a second mold 12 and the first mold 5 can be placed up and down correspondingly, thereby facilitating the molding work of the material.
According to the drawings of fig. 1, fig. 2 and fig. 3, the top cover 9 is fixed on the bearing table 1 through the stud bolts 10, the lower end surface of the top cover 9 is provided with the second groove 11, the second groove 11 is internally provided with the second mold 12, the second mold 12 is in threaded connection with the top cover 9 through the second fixing bolt 13, the number of the second mold 12 and the number of the first mold 5 are three, one second mold 12 and one first mold 5 are arranged into a group, the second mold 12 can be fixed on the top cover 9 by rotating the second fixing bolt 13, when the three second molds 12 and the three first molds 5 work together, the three sealing rings can be shaped simultaneously, so as to improve the working efficiency, the second mold 12 is fixed on the top cover 9 through the second fixing bolt 13, the upper side of the second mold 12 and the upper end surface of the top cover 9 are provided with the through holes 14, the through holes 14 are symmetrically arranged, the material can enter between the first die sleeve 7 and the second die 12 through the through holes 14, and the symmetrically arranged through holes 14 can enable the material to be injected more uniformly, so that the shaping quality is improved.
The working principle is as follows: when the sealing ring processing and shaping device is used, firstly, the device is placed at a required place, the device is connected to an external power supply, materials are injected between a first die 5 and a second die 12 through a through hole 14, materials can be injected between three groups of first die sleeves 7 and three groups of second die 12, the three groups of materials can be conveniently shaped simultaneously, so that the working efficiency of the device is improved, meanwhile, an electric water valve 3 is opened, water and a condensing agent can enter a water storage tank 2 under the action of an external water pump, at the moment, the first die sleeves 7 are positioned in the water and the condensing agent, so that the materials are cooled and shaped, after the shaping is finished, a stud 10 is reversed, a top cover 9 is taken down, a second fixing bolt 13 is reversed to take down the second die 12, then the first fixing bolt 6 is rotated to take out the first die 5 and the first die sleeves 7, the surfaces of the first die sleeves 7 are conveniently cleaned, and used next time, this completes the work and is within the skill of the art, not described in detail in this specification.
